The Allen-Bradley Guardmaster Minotaur MSR57P safe-speed monitoring relay is designed to let personnel enter hazardous areas while parts travel at speeds considered to be below a safe level. The device supports numerous input devices such as E-stops, light curtains, enabling switches, and interlock switches, which detect demands on the safety system and initiate a stop request of the motion. It also monitors personnel in the hazardous area while the machine is in a safe-speed condition. Motion is monitored via one or two encoders.
